No kit, it's just 6 bolts and a snap ring you have to deal with. Take the old hub bolts off, remove the snap ring over the axle shaft, remove the rest of the hub internals in one piece (both how-tos out there show part being removed before the snap ring and the rest after, BAD IDEA), then put the Warn internals on, the snap ring (now in the outer groove of the shaft) and the Warn outer portion on.

Get some actual socket/hex-key bolts instead of the crappy studs Warn provides, info here somewhere...
